The latest Q Magazine offers an exclusive interview with the former The Verve frontman Richard Ashcroft. Equipped with his new band, United Nations of Sound, and a new hip hop influenced direction, he talks about The Verve, the split, his new band mates, being a frontman, and more.

RPA and the United Nations of Sound
From left to right: Steve Wyreman (guitar), Dwayne "DW" Wright (bass), Richard Ashcroft (vocals and acoustic guitar), Benjamin Wright (string arrangements), Derrick Wright (drums)
Album release date
RPA & the United Nations of Sound debut album will be released on June 7th on Parlophone. The album was recorded in New York, Los Angeles and London, and produced by Chicago hip-hop pioneer No I.D.

As some may have guessed, Richard Ashcroft's upcoming album has been pushed back. Originally listed for release at the tail end of March, the date is now "to be confirmed." More information as it becomes available.
In spite of this, the wheels are still turning. This week, Parlophone announced the creation of the RPA Club. Some of the perks include:
- exclusive access to Richard Ashcroft & United Nations of Sound content
- limited edition RPA t-shirt only available to fan club members
- access to exclusive pre-sales on gig tickets (subject to availability)
- exclusive fan club only shows
- access to exclusive track titled "Third Eye (Columbus Circle)" upon sign up
- a further 3 tracks throughout the 12 months of membership
Crowned Producer of the Year for 2009 by Hip Hop DX, Chicago-born No I.D. has basically circumnavigated the Hip Hop ocean with his unique musical interpretations and soundscapes. "Third Eye," the second tune released from this collaboration, is a departure from Richard Ashcroft's previous work. The vibe and vocal style of "Third Eye" are unlike anything we've heard from Richard before and gets major praise in my book.

In May 2009, a link was posted to several personal videos that had surfaced from Verve's 1997 U.S. Tour, presumably from Simon Tong's video camera. For the note, the official Verve video (96-98) showed Simon Tong holding a video camera filming a cityscape upon an overlook, so the footage is probably his.
